Handball venues confirmed for Paris 2024 with arenas in Lille and the capital

Arena 6 of South Paris and Stade Pierre-Mauroy in Lille have been approved as handball venues for the 2024 Olympic Games in the French capital. South Paris Arena 6 is part of the Paris Expo, an exhibition and convention center that is one of the most active in Europe.

On its 35 hectares and 228,000 square meters of exhibition halls and eight pavilions, the exhibition welcomes more than 7.5 million tourists annually and as a result is the most visited attraction of its kind in France. It is due to host the preliminaries in Paris 2024 and also host weightlifting before handball at the Paralympics.

For handball, it must accommodate between 7,300 and 7,800 people. The playoffs of the men’s and women’s tournaments are scheduled to be held at the Stade Pierre-Mauroy. Opened in 2012, it has a retractable roof, seats 50,186 and is home to the Lille OSC football team, which became Ligue 1 champions in 2021.

In addition to football, it has also hosted handball, basketball, tennis and rugby competitions in the past. He hosted three matches in the 2017 IHF Men’s Handball World Championship, setting a record crowd of 28,010 in the quarter-final between France and Sweden, which was won by the hosts en route to winning the trophy.

The Stade Pierre-Mauroy is also set to host basketball games in Paris 2024 after lengthy negotiations. It was eventually approved as the venue for major international competitions. The arena set a European basketball game attendance record with 27,372 spectators at the EuroBasket final in 2015.

Paris 2024 aims to keep Olympians, Paralympians cool without air conditioners

Organizers plan to use a water-cooling system under the Athletes’ Village – much like the one that helped the Louvre weather the sweltering heat wave that broke records last year – to control the temperature for the Olympians and Paralympians who are stationed there.

The decision is part of the organizing committee’s goal to cut the carbon footprint of the Olympic Paris Games by half and host the greenest Olympics to date by installing special technology that uses natural sources to keep everyone cool even during potential heatwaves. “I want the Olympic Paris to be environmentally exemplary, said Paris Mayor Anne Hidalgo, who has decided to fight climate change with an ambitious action plan to drastically reduce greenhouse gas emissions and turn the City of Lights into carbon. neutral by 2050.”

Compared to a conventional project, the Athletes’ Village’s carbon footprint will be reduced by 45% during the construction phase and throughout the Olympic cycle, she said.

For two months, from July to September 2024, the Athletes’ Village north of Paris will host 15,600 athletes and sports officials during the Olympic Games and 9,000 athletes and their support teams during the Paralympic Games. After the games, the 50-hectare (125-acre) site next to the River Seine in the popular Saint-Denis neighborhood will become a green, zero-carbon residential and commercial area with 6,000 residents. those who move as early as 2025.

In anticipation of the heat, the organizers studied the heat in the Athletes’ Village quarter by quarter. They simulated the conditions in the parts of the room most exposed to the sun and tested the efficiency of the cooling system to keep the room temperature between 23 and 26 degrees Celsius (73 and 79 degrees Fahrenheit).

The geothermal energy system will ensure that temperatures in athletes’ apartments in the suburb of Seine-Saint-Denis do not rise above 26 degrees Celsius (79 degrees Fahrenheit) at night, including during potential heat waves, said Laurent Michaud, director of the Olympic 2024 and Paralympic Communities.

He said the organizers conducted the tests in rooms located on the upper floors of the residences, facing south and exposed to direct sunlight from two sides. The direction of the winds in the region and the water temperature in the Seine were also taken into account. They worked closely with the French National Meteorological Agency to develop temperature forecasts.

“Even though the outdoor temperature reaches 41 degrees Celsius (106 degrees Fahrenheit), in most of these rooms we had a temperature of 28 degrees (82 degrees Fahrenheit), Michaud told the Associated Press, detailing the results of thermal simulation. waves. We clearly had lower temperatures in other rooms.”

In addition to underfloor cooling, insulation built into buildings will allow occupants to keep the cold they get at night during the day, Michaud says. To keep the inside cool, athletes will have to follow some basic rules, he said, including making sure window blinds are closed during the day.

Laurent Monnet, who is in charge of green crossing at Saint-Denis City Hall, the northern suburb of Paris where the main Olympic village will be located, said all rooms should be 6 degrees Celsius (11 degrees Fahrenheit) cooler than outside. without AC unit. While some Olympic 2024 hopefuls have already raised concerns about the lack of air conditioning, Monnet said athletes need to adapt and do their part to fight climate change.

“We need athletes to lead by example when they use buildings, Monet said. We can build the most virtuous village we want, and how it is used will affect our carbon footprint.”

Eliud Kipchoge, two-time Olympic champion and world marathon record holder, supported the Paris Plan for Sustainable Development. The Kenyan is one of the most vocal advocates of environmental justice in sport and has repeatedly sounded the alarm about climate change and the impact of global warming.

It’s a good idea because we all need to cut our carbon footprint, Kipchoge told AP. He called on fellow athletes to help fight climate change by reducing their carbon footprint during competition, training and their lives in general because we are all about to go through the same scenario.

The Paris 2024 organizers have contacted the national Olympic committees and said they will have the option to install their own AC units in certain cases and provided the units meet the organizing committee’s technical criteria.

Most national Olympic officials reacted to plans to keep their athletes cool during the Summer Games with a wait-and-see attitude. Some Olympic officials have not ruled out bringing their own air conditioners to France or paying for them locally, depending on the weather at the time.

The Australian Olympic Committee said it will be monitoring weather conditions in Paris 2024 in the coming year to ensure optimal high-performance conditions for our athletes, including temperature and humidity reductions that may be required.

Michaud, the director of the Olympic Village, said organizers want to be kind to the environment, but not endanger the health of athletes. Some athletes, especially in Paralympic events, have difficulty regulating their body’s core temperature and if they reside in rooms in which it proves impossible to keep at 26 degrees Celsius (79 degrees Fahrenheit) at night, national delegations will be able to install a portable AC system.

Michaud said this would be on a case-by-case basis and for the health and safety of the athletes, adding that instead of traditional air conditioners, fans could be installed to evaporate water droplets. Hidalgo, the mayor of Paris, is strongly opposed to turning next year’s event into the Bring Your Air Conditioner Olympic 2024 program, barring a health exception.
